MetaMask Extension® – Your Gateway to the Decentralized Web
MetaMask Extension – Your Secure Ethereum Wallet for Browsers
The MetaMask Extension is a widely used cryptocurrency wallet that integrates directly into your browser. Available for Chrome, Firefox, Edge, and Brave, it allows users to manage Ethereum (ETH) and ERC-20 tokens, send and receive crypto, and interact with decentralized applications (dApps) securely.
MetaMask gives users full control of their private keys, ensuring that funds remain under your control at all times. It is an essential tool for anyone engaging with Ethereum-based networks, DeFi platforms, and NFT marketplaces.
What is the MetaMask Extension?
MetaMask Extension is a browser-based cryptocurrency wallet that provides:
- Secure storage for Ethereum and ERC-20 tokens.
- Access to decentralized applications (dApps) directly from your browser.
- Local encryption of private keys.
- Integration with hardware wallets like Ledger and Trezor.
Unlike custodial wallets, MetaMask does not store your private keys online. This non-custodial setup gives you complete control over your cryptocurrency.
Key Features of the MetaMask Extension
1. Multi-Token Support
MetaMask supports Ethereum and all ERC-20 tokens, as well as Ethereum-compatible networks such as Binance Smart Chain (BSC), Polygon, Avalanche, and others.
2. Browser Integration
The extension integrates seamlessly with Chrome, Firefox, Edge, and Brave, allowing users to connect to dApps, decentralized exchanges (DEXs), and NFT platforms.
3. Secure Private Key Storage
All private keys are encrypted and stored locally on your device. MetaMask does not have access to your funds, ensuring that only you control your assets.
4. Transaction Management
The MetaMask Extension allows you to send and receive crypto, adjust Ethereum gas fees, and view transaction history, all with secure confirmation steps.
5. Network Management
You can connect MetaMask to multiple networks, including Ethereum mainnet, testnets, and custom RPC networks. This is useful for developers and traders who interact with different blockchain environments.
How to Install the MetaMask Extension
Step 1: Visit the Official Website
Go to the official MetaMask website: https://metamask.io
⚠️ Only download from the official website to avoid phishing attacks.
Step 2: Choose Your Browser
Select your browser (Chrome, Firefox, Edge, or Brave) and click “Install Extension”.
Step 3: Add to Browser
- Click “Add to Chrome” (or your respective browser).
- Confirm installation by clicking “Add Extension.”
Step 4: Launch MetaMask
- Click the MetaMask icon in your browser toolbar.
- You will see the welcome screen with options to “Get Started.”
Setting Up the MetaMask Extension
Step 1: Create a Wallet
- Click “Create a Wallet.”
- Decide whether to allow analytics data collection.
Step 2: Set a Strong Password
- This password will protect access to your MetaMask Extension on your browser.
Step 3: Backup Your Secret Recovery Phrase
- MetaMask will generate a 12-word Secret Recovery Phrase.
- Write it down and store it offline in a secure place.
⚠️ Never store it digitally or share it. Losing the recovery phrase means losing access to your wallet.
Step 4: Confirm Your Recovery Phrase
- Select the words in the correct order to verify your backup.
Once confirmed, your MetaMask Extension wallet is ready to use.
Adding Tokens to MetaMask
- Open MetaMask and go to Assets.
- Click “Import Tokens.”
- Search for the token or paste its contract address.
- Click “Add Token.”
Your wallet will now track and manage additional tokens securely.
Sending and Receiving Cryptocurrency
Receiving Crypto
- Click “Account” to copy your public address.
- Verify the address on your device or extension before sharing.
- Use this address to receive ETH or tokens.
Sending Crypto
- Click “Send” in MetaMask.
- Enter the recipient address and amount.
- Adjust gas fees if necessary.
- Confirm the transaction.
All outgoing transactions require confirmation, ensuring security even if your browser is compromised.
Connecting MetaMask Extension to dApps
- Open a dApp (e.g., Uniswap, OpenSea) in your browser.
- Click “Connect Wallet” and choose MetaMask.
- Approve the connection from the extension.
Once connected, you can safely interact with decentralized exchanges, DeFi protocols, NFT marketplaces, and other Ethereum-based applications.
Security Features of MetaMask Extension
- Encrypted Private Keys: Stored locally on your device.
- Secret Recovery Phrase: Required only for wallet recovery.
- Phishing Protection: Alerts for known malicious websites.
- Transaction Confirmation: All outgoing transactions must be approved manually.
- Hardware Wallet Integration: Supports Ledger and Trezor for added security.
Troubleshooting MetaMask Extension
- Extension Not Appearing: Ensure your browser is updated; reinstall if necessary.
- Cannot Send Funds: Check the network, gas fees, and token compatibility.
- Wallet Not Loading: Clear browser cache and refresh.
- Lost Recovery Phrase: Cannot restore wallet without the phrase; always back it up securely.
- Connection Issues with dApps: Disconnect and reconnect the wallet, or refresh the webpage.
Best Practices
- Always download the MetaMask Extension from https://metamask.io.
- Backup your Secret Recovery Phrase offline.
- Enable two-factor authentication and hardware wallet integration for added security.
- Confirm all transactions manually on the extension.
- Avoid public Wi-Fi when accessing MetaMask.
- Disconnect from dApps when not in use.
- Keep your browser updated to prevent vulnerabilities.
Conclusion
The MetaMask Extension is a secure and convenient tool for managing Ethereum and ERC-20 tokens, interacting with dApps, and accessing DeFi and NFT platforms directly from your browser. By combining a non-custodial wallet with strong encryption, private key control, and transaction confirmations, MetaMask ensures that users maintain full ownership of their digital assets.
Install the MetaMask Extension from the official site: https://metamask.io and start safely managing your Ethereum wallet today.